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between Group Public Liability and Instructor Public and Products Liability?

Group Public Liability provides indemnity for your legal liability for damages, including claimant legal costs arising out of accidental injury to any person (other than employees), accidental loss or damage to third party property, nuisance and trespass and member to member indemnity.

Instructor Public and Products Liability provides a personal indemnity to an Instructor for liability arising from their instruction, demonstration or supervision of martial arts activity including legal defence costs.

What is Member to Member cover?

This forms part of the Group Public and Products Liability policy and provides cover for one Member to another Member for negligent injury. This is not a form of Personal Accident Insurance.

Why is Personal Accident insurance different to Public and Products Liability cover?

Personal Accident cover provides a benefit (subject to the policy terms) if a member is injured whilst participating in Martial Arts regardless of negligence. Liability cover is an indemnity for Legal Liability.

What is Products Liability cover?

Product Liability provides indemnity for Legal Liability arising from the sale of goods. This may include for example, the sale of clothing, protective equipment, literature, food and drink. Product Liability is automatically included in our Instructor and Club Liability covers.
